2025-08-31 LocalStorage怎么使用,localestorage LocalStorage怎么使用,localestorage 本文深入解析LocalStorage的核心用法,通过真实场景案例演示如何实现数据本地持久化,对比SessionStorage差异,并提供企业级应用的最佳实践方案。在Web开发中,数据存储始终是构建交互式应用的关键环节。当我们需要在浏览器端持久化保存用户偏好设置、表单草稿或轻量级业务数据时,LocalStorage无疑是最值得信赖的伙伴。与需要服务端配合的Cookie不同,LocalStorage纯粹运行在客户端,提供最大5MB的存储空间,且不会随HTTP请求自动发送到服务器,这种特性使其成为前端存储敏感数据的理想选择。一、LocalStorage基础操作1. 存储数据的三重境界javascript // 基础存储(字符串) localStorage.setItem('theme', 'dark-mode');// 对象存储(需序列化) const userSettings = { fontSize: 14, notifications: true }; localStorage.setItem('preferences', JSON.stringify(userSettings)... 2025年08月31日 31 阅读 0 评论
2025-08-13 HTML5的localStorage和sessionStorage有什么区别?,localstorage与sessionstorage HTML5的localStorage和sessionStorage有什么区别?,localstorage与sessionstorage 一、前言:浏览器存储的革命2014年HTML5标准正式发布时,其引入的Web Storage API彻底改变了前端数据存储的格局。作为曾在jQuery时代依赖Cookie存数据的开发者,我清晰记得第一次使用localStorage.setItem()时的震撼——不需要服务端参与,不需要处理HTTP头,简单两行代码就能实现数据持久化。但很多人对同属Web Storage的sessionStorage却知之甚少,今天我们就来揭开这对"存储双生子"的神秘面纱。二、核心差异对比1. 生命周期:数据存多久? localStorage:数据理论上永久保存,除非: 用户手动清除浏览器缓存 开发者调用localStorage.clear() 超过浏览器配额(通常2.5MB-10MB) sessionStorage:数据仅在当前会话有效: 关闭浏览器标签页立即销毁 刷新页面保持数据(同源策略下) 通过JavaScript主动删除 2021年Chrome 88版本更新后,即使浏览器崩溃恢复的标签页也会保留sessionStorage,这是多数开发者不知道的细节。2. 作用域:谁能访问?j... 2025年08月13日 36 阅读 0 评论